Output d59519e641a425e66ed95d9fead4f77c4b97e5a1d9423e8ca9ae45a0c11f37ec:1

value
159140722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b193590aca06525612a71f8633dc991e420df24a OP_EQUAL
address
3Hsx3QNgsobYcKbP6NwitFkxWkTYiZTM5g
transaction
d59519e641a425e66ed95d9fead4f77c4b97e5a1d9423e8ca9ae45a0c11f37ec
spent
true